In the middle of a dense forest of coniferous trees lies the Aurora Borealis pack, its name coming from its location. At certain times of the year, the northern lights appear, dancing almost magically in the sky. A narrow trail leads you through the close evergreens. Giving into temptation, you begin moving your paws. By venturing into this territory, you are venturing into a land belonging to a pair of feared leaders. You have heard rumors of them...but you decide to take your chances and hope that the tales of blood and death are merely fabricated stories to scare wolves.

You have walked nearly five minutes before you realize the sound of paws stepping somewhere from behind. Deciding that you've made a mistake, you quickly turn around, but find that you cannot go any further. Standing before you is one of the mighty kings you've heard of. His blood red pelt clings over perfectly toned bands of muscle. But that isn't what causes such fear in your veins. One of his amber eyes has a horrid, bleeding scar across it, and his good eye seems to stare right through you. His face is expressionless, giving off none of his intentions. You cower away as his jaws part.

"I'm Hell Demon."

His voice was deep and cut through the air like a hot knife through butter. Right where he left off, another voice picks up from behind you. You whirl around and find yourself facing another male with steely muscles beneath his pelt, which seems to consist of every shade of brown. He had startled you, and you're amazed how you hadn't at all detected his approach.

"And I am Ghost...we're the alphas of Aurora Borealis."

His deep voice was laced thickly with a Native American accent. His own golden eyes are directing a harsh glare your way. Now you're caught in the middle...your breathing has become heavy in your panic and you're not sure which to face.

"You've foolishly trespassed into our territory. You face the one called Hell Demon's whose voice is once more addressing you. Get out, or become a corpse along our border."

It's obvious they mean business. So now it's up to you...take your chances and stay, or heed their warning and waste no time getting out with your life.

The brute rose, answering the fae “It is no inconvenience, Chenzii, for the sun is dipping and I shall need to get rest soon as well. I was planning to travel to my favorite grove now anyway, so I shall simply help you find one before I retire.” Kalgalath headed back towards the trees as Chenzii followed him. She was grateful to be back under the cover of the trees. Chenzii always felt uneasy being out in the open and she would much prefer to be under the cover of the trees. Feeling the softer ground covered in the fallen leaves on her pads made her feel more at ease than the gravel near the lake, although the lake was a pleasurable and beautiful place. After a few minutes of walking through the forest a wall of dense trees came into view and Kalgalath again spoke to Chenzii before disappearing through the branches, “It may look like a wall of trees, but travel straight and through.”

As Chenzii looked on at the thick branches that did not seem like they could hold any dens, memories began to swarm her mind. The dense wall of trees reminded Chenzii of the dens that were in Chenzii’s old pack with her mother and brother. The night of the fire flashed through her mind, Chenzii and her brother, Lucien, sleeping together in their den. Hearing her mother’s piercing howl startling her to wake instantly. The young fae had leapt to her feet, pulling her brother who was still fairly young, as he shook himself awake. The smell of smoke and ash came to Chenzii’s nostrils and she could sense the panic of her pack. As Chenzii was running out of the den her mother came bounding over, telling her and her brother to run, pointing with her muzzle in the direction away from the fire. Chenzii started leading her brother to safety, assuming her mother would follow. When Chenzii turned her head to look for her mother she saw her bounding away towards the other dens to warn the other wolves in their pack. Chenzii’s heart leapt with fear seeing her mother running back towards the danger of the fire, but she knew that had to lead her brother to safety. That was the last time that Chenzii saw her mother and it brought great sorrow to her heart to remember that night.

Chenzii shook her head, trying to stop the memories from flooding her mind. The fae pushed forward through the trees, following the large brute towards the groves, anxious to see what it would lead to.
